My memories now have a separate life of their own. ~ Kuala Lumpur Experimental Film, Video & Music Festival (KLEX), the artists-run, grassroots international festival of experimental film and music, is back with its eighth edition, “KLEX 2017: Crossing Over”, on 24-26 November 2017 at RAW Art Space and Checkmate Creative. The festival includes: KLEX Open Programmes with selected works from the open call from Africa, Asia, Canada, Europe and USA; International Guest Programmes and artist lectures from Germany, Japan, Korea and Singapore; and music and audio-visual performances. Over 70 experimental shorts from Africa, Asia, Canada, Europe & USA will be screened; and 22 local and international performers will be joining the music and audio-visual programme.
